My colleague Dan Seifert reviewed this Eero model, and he praised it for being easy to set up and use. It isn’t the fastest mesh Wi-Fi system, though, and he notes that mostly comes down to their lack of a third 5GHz band, which the more expensive Eero Pro features. Having this band helps to keep internet speeds from dropping off when your devices are connected to nodes located farther away from your modem — which is to say that, with this model, the speed degrades as you move farther away from the router connected to your modem via Ethernet. Still, this Eero system nails maintaining a solid connection with devices.
